CEN/TC 166 N 2138, Revision of EN 1856-1 Chimneys — Requirements for metal chimneys — Part 1: System chimney products

Scope

This document specifies the characteristics of performance for single and multi-wall system chimneys with rigid metal liners composed of chimney sections, chimney fittings, terminals and supports with nominal diameter up to and including 1200 mm, used to convey the products of combustion from appliances to the outside atmosphere.

This document also specifies characteristics for the air supply ducts of concentric chimneys for room-sealed application, made out of metal or plastic (without fibre stabilization). Additionally, it specifies assessment and verification of constancy of performance (AVCP).

NOTE 1 Metal liners and metal connecting flue pipes, not covered, are included in prEN 1856-2:2020.

NOTE 2 This document does not apply to structurally independent chimneys.

Purpose

EN 1856-1 has been under revision for the last 3 years, but unfortunately it received lack of compliance assessment from HAS Consultant at the CEN Enquiry stage. There was a need to address major changes to the previous draft, and therefore a second CEN Enquiry and additional HAS assessment is required.

Given the current timeframe, it is not possible to comply with initial scheduled deadline, and therefore deletion of previous WI and registration of new one is needed to continue with the usual procedure (see CEN/TC 166/SC2 N 922) The revised draft prEN 1856-1takes into consideration comments from first CEN Enquiry and HAS Consultant and it has been approved by TC 166/SC2.
